Why Standard Brushing and Cheap Rinses Fail to Stop Morning Odor

You brush diligently every night, floss, and maybe even use a mouthwash before bed. Yet, you still wake up with that familiar, unpleasant “morning breath.” It can be frustrating and make you feel like your efforts are for nothing. The truth is, this issue is not a failure of your hygiene routine but a matter of biology.

Overnight, your saliva production decreases, creating a dry, low-oxygen environment in your mouth. This is the perfect breeding ground for anaerobic bacteria, which live on the back of your tongue and in your throat. These bacteria feed on proteins and produce smelly byproducts called volatile sulfur compounds (VSCs). These VSCs are the direct cause of morning halitosis, and no amount of brushing can completely stop this natural overnight process.

Many common drugstore rinses attempt to solve this problem with a blast of alcohol and strong minty flavors. While this provides an immediate sensation of freshness, it’s a temporary mask that often makes the problem worse. Alcohol is a drying agent; it strips your mouth of its natural moisture. This leads to a “rebound effect” where the dry environment allows the odor-causing bacteria to return even stronger a few hours later. In a humid climate, where you frequently move between outdoor heat and dry, air-conditioned indoors, this cycle of dehydration and rehydration can accelerate mouth dryness, making the problem even more pronounced and difficult to manage.

The Clinical Science Behind Therabreath’s Oxygenating Formula

Instead of masking odors or indiscriminately killing all bacteria, Therabreath’s formula takes a more targeted, scientific approach. Developed by a dentist, its efficacy is rooted in disrupting the very environment that bad breath bacteria need to survive. The core of the formula is an active ingredient known as OXYD-8, a stabilized form of chlorine dioxide that generates oxygenating power when it comes into contact with your saliva.

Here’s how it works on a molecular level:

  1. The anaerobic bacteria responsible for bad breath thrive in low-oxygen conditions.
  2. When you rinse with Therabreath, the oxygenating compounds are activated.
  3. This process neutralizes the volatile sulfur compounds (VSCs), instantly converting the smelly gas into a tasteless, odorless sulfate.
  4. It also creates an oxygen-rich environment in the mouth, which inhibits the anaerobic bacteria from producing more VSCs.

This mechanism is fundamentally different from standard antiseptic rinses. Those products often use high concentrations of alcohol or other harsh agents to kill all bacteria—both good and bad. Wiping out your entire oral microbiome can disrupt its natural balance and lead to dryness and irritation. Therabreath’s targeted action focuses specifically on the sulfur-producing culprits without causing collateral damage. Realistic Expectations: How Long Does the Freshness Actually Last?

One of the most common questions is about the duration of freshness: how long does a single rinse actually last? Clinical studies and user reports confirm that Therabreath can provide freshness for 12 to 24 hours under optimal conditions. This extended duration is a key differentiator from rinses that offer only a fleeting minty sensation. The oxygenating formula doesn’t just mask odor; it continues to neutralize sulfur compounds long after you’ve finished rinsing.

However, it’s important to set realistic expectations. The actual duration can vary based on several personal factors:

  • Hydration: Staying well-hydrated throughout the day helps maintain saliva flow, which supports the formula's effectiveness.
  • Diet: Consuming foods with strong odors like garlic, onions, or certain spices can naturally impact your breath from the inside out.
  • Lifestyle Habits: Drinking coffee or acidic beverages can alter your mouth's pH and may reduce the longevity of the fresh feeling.
  • Oral Microbiome: Everyone's mouth has a unique balance of bacteria.

For most people, rinsing twice a day—once in the morning and once before bed—is sufficient to maintain confidence around the clock. You might consider an extra rinse after a particularly strong meal or a long commute in a dry, air-conditioned vehicle. The key takeaway is that consistency is more important than a single-use miracle. Integrating it into your daily oral care routine is what unlocks the long-term, reliable results.

Optimizing Your Routine for Consistent Results in Humid Conditions

To get the maximum benefit from Therabreath and ensure consistent 12- to 24-hour freshness, it’s essential to integrate it correctly into your daily routine. Simply swishing for a few seconds isn’t enough to activate its full potential. Follow these steps for optimal performance, especially in warm and humid climates where oral hygiene requires extra attention.

  1. Brush and Floss First: Always start by brushing your teeth and flossing to remove food particles and plaque. This clears the way for the rinse to work directly on the bacteria on your tongue and soft tissues.
  2. Use the Right Amount: Pour one capful of the rinse into a cup.
  3. Rinse Your Mouth: Swish the first half of the capful vigorously around your mouth for at least 30 seconds. This ensures the formula reaches all areas, including your cheeks and gums.
  4. Gargle for the Finish: With the second half of the capful, tilt your head back and gargle for another 30 seconds. This step is crucial as it targets the hard-to-reach anaerobic bacteria at the very back of the tongue and throat, which are a primary source of bad breath.
  5. Don't Rinse with Water: After spitting out the mouthwash, avoid eating, drinking, or rinsing your mouth with water for at least 5-10 minutes. Rinsing with water immediately will dilute the active oxygenating compounds and reduce their effectiveness.
  6. Incorporate Tongue Scraping: For an even more powerful effect, use a tongue scraper before you rinse. This physically removes a significant portion of the bacterial biofilm where VSCs are produced.
  7. Proper Storage: In warm, humid climates, store the bottle in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ight to maintain the stability and potency of the formula.
